home *** CD-ROM | disk | FTP | other *** search
/ Aminet 38 / Aminet 38 (2000)(Schatztruhe)[!][Aug 2000].iso / Aminet / dev / misc / TCS.readme < prev   
Encoding:
Text File  |  2000-07-01  |  4.7 KB  |  119 lines

  1. Short:    Fast 8-bit Chunky TrueColor on AGA
  2. Author:   bevilacq@cli.di.unipi.it (Simone Bevilacqua)
  3. Uploader: bevilacq@cli.di.unipi.it (Simone Bevilacqua)
  4. Type:     dev/misc
  5. Requires: AGA, 020+ CPU, KS 2.04+
  6.  
  7. Replaces  dev/misc/TCS.lha
  8.  
  9.  
  10.  
  11. The Tricky Color System (TCS) is a new, fantastic, software-only, video
  12. system which provides some new cool video modes on normal AGA Amigas by
  13. exploiting some basic concepts of the composition of colors.
  14. It comes in the shape of a shared library, but, if you want, you can
  15. write you own routines thanks to the detailed documentation which fully
  16. describes the system's internals.
  17.  
  18.  
  19.  
  20. Library Features list:
  21.  
  22.  - multiple RGB-like color definitions, named "RGBx"
  23.  
  24.  - TrueColor-like pixels, i.e. the value of a pixel is its own RGBx value,
  25.    not an index to a color lookup table
  26.  
  27.  - chunky access, i.e. a pixel value is read/written with an access to a
  28.    single memory location
  29.  
  30.  - 2 horizontal resolutions: HalfRes, FullRes (280 ns, 140 ns pixels)
  31.  
  32.  - all the display sizes allowable by the Amiga hardware
  33.  
  34.  - screens of any size (limited only by the available memory)
  35.  
  36.  - 256 independently selectable colors per screen
  37.  
  38.  - up to 256 unique colors per screen
  39.  
  40.  - variable display brightness
  41.  
  42.  - Cross Playfield mode (a kind of Dual Playfield mode without a trasparent
  43.    color and with variable front playfield opacity)
  44.                                                                           
  45.  - up to 337 unique indipendent colors in Dual Cross Playfield mode
  46.    (Cross Playfield mode with selectable transparent color)
  47.  
  48.  - scrollable screens with horizontal increments of 35 ns
  49.  
  50.  - double and triple buffered screens
  51.  
  52.  - many graphic primitives + several other special graphic functions
  53.  
  54.  - Graphic Contexts -based displays
  55.  
  56.  - functions for pictures files handling
  57.  
  58.  - functions for palette/color control
  59.  
  60.  & even more!
  61.  
  62.  
  63. ============================= Archive contents =============================
  64.  
  65. Original  Packed Ratio    Date     Time    Name
  66. -------- ------- ----- --------- --------  -------------
  67.    14321    4846 66.1% 26-Jun-00 16:22:56 +basix.guide
  68.     4945    2186 55.7% 26-Jun-00 16:22:56 +intro.guide
  69.   132936   28281 78.7% 26-Jun-00 16:22:56 +lib.guide
  70.    11282    3714 67.0% 26-Jun-00 16:22:56 +main.guide
  71.     1400     949 32.2% 26-Jun-00 16:22:56 +main.guide.info
  72.   144441   44950 68.8% 26-Jun-00 16:22:56 +tech.guide
  73.     1028     549 46.5% 26-Jun-00 16:23:02 +DubBuf
  74.     1020     538 47.2% 26-Jun-00 16:23:02 +FullRes
  75.      996     532 46.5% 26-Jun-00 16:23:02 +HalfRes
  76.     1364     718 47.3% 26-Jun-00 16:23:02 +ILBM&Fade
  77.     1268     676 46.6% 26-Jun-00 16:23:02 +RmpILBM
  78.      400     275 31.2% 26-Jun-00 16:23:00 +SvRGBxPal
  79.     1132     593 47.6% 26-Jun-00 16:23:02 +TriBuf
  80.     1156     612 47.0% 26-Jun-00 16:23:02 +TriBuf&BltFRP
  81.     1444     783 45.7% 26-Jun-00 16:23:02 +TriBuf&Zm
  82.     2464    1018 58.6% 26-Jun-00 16:23:02 +XPfld
  83.     1041     439 57.8% 26-Jun-00 16:22:58 +dat.i
  84.     1008     298 70.4% 26-Jun-00 16:22:58 +macros.i
  85.     6389    1919 69.9% 26-Jun-00 16:22:58 +shl_strtup.i
  86.    61650   47767 22.5% 26-Jun-00 16:23:00 +Alphonse.iff
  87.    67202   55309 17.6% 26-Jun-00 16:23:00 +Alphonse_rgbh.iff
  88.    46546   17234 62.9% 26-Jun-00 16:23:00 +DXP_rgbh.iff
  89.    81464   72001 11.6% 26-Jun-00 16:23:00 +TM.iff
  90.    76034   63339 16.6% 26-Jun-00 16:23:00 +TM_rgb332.iff
  91.    79356   67506 14.9% 26-Jun-00 16:23:00 +TM_rgbm.iff
  92.    79608   68662 13.7% 26-Jun-00 16:23:00 +TM_rgbp.iff
  93.    79326   67143 15.3% 26-Jun-00 16:23:00 +TM_rgbs.iff
  94.    72496   60555 16.4% 26-Jun-00 16:23:00 +TM_rgbw.iff
  95.     1342     441 67.1% 26-Jun-00 16:22:58 +readme
  96.      302     199 34.1% 26-Jun-00 16:22:58 +do
  97.     2540     723 71.5% 26-Jun-00 16:22:58 +DubBuf.s
  98.     2398     648 72.9% 26-Jun-00 16:22:58 +FullRes.s
  99.     2325     623 73.2% 26-Jun-00 16:22:58 +HalfRes.s
  100.     4119    1411 65.7% 26-Jun-00 16:22:58 +ILBM&Fade.s
  101.     3887    1336 65.6% 26-Jun-00 16:22:58 +RmpILBM.s
  102.     2661     940 64.6% 26-Jun-00 16:22:58 +SvRGBxPal.s
  103.     3398    1033 69.5% 26-Jun-00 16:22:58 +TriBuf&BltFRP.s
  104.     5007    1867 62.7% 26-Jun-00 16:22:58 +TriBuf&Zm.s
  105.     3129     935 70.1% 26-Jun-00 16:22:58 +TriBuf.s
  106.    10545    2414 77.1% 26-Jun-00 16:22:58 +XPfld.s
  107.    10376    2767 73.3% 26-Jun-00 16:22:58 +tcs.i
  108.     2381     630 73.5% 26-Jun-00 16:22:58 +tcs_lib.i
  109.    24348   12686 47.8% 26-Jun-00 16:23:02 +tcs.library
  110.      223     173 22.4% 26-Jun-00 16:22:56 +readme
  111.      828     433 47.7% 26-Jun-00 16:22:56 +RGB332.iff
  112.      828     425 48.6% 26-Jun-00 16:22:56 +RGBH.iff
  113.      828     407 50.8% 26-Jun-00 16:22:56 +RGBM.iff
  114.      828     426 48.5% 26-Jun-00 16:22:56 +RGBP.iff
  115.      828     379 54.2% 26-Jun-00 16:22:56 +RGBS.iff
  116.      828     355 57.1% 26-Jun-00 16:22:56 +RGBW.iff
  117. -------- ------- ----- --------- --------
  118.  1057666  644643 39.0% 28-Jun-100 13:14:34   50 files
  119.